Your commute to Oakland and around the city of Pittsburgh just got easier. As a Carlow student, you have access to unlimited, fare-free rides on any Pittsburgh Regional Transit (PRT, formerly Port Authority Transit) systems through the newly mobile U-Pass program.

With a bus stop right outside our front door, you can explore Pittsburgh and all it has to offer completely fare-free and without hassle.

To be eligible, you must be a registered Â鶹¾«Æ· student on our main Oakland campus or at our Westmoreland or Cranberry education centers.*. Online-only students may contact Student Accounts and request access to the U-Pass. Access to the U-Pass program is semester-by-semester.

Pittsburgh Regional Transit provides services to Oakland, Pittsburgh and throughout Allegheny County. Transportation systems include bus, light rail vehicle and Pittsburgh’s famous incline.


*Students who are registered for a given semester (i.e. Fall 2022 and are charged the $60.00 transportation fee) are eligible for the U-Pass program for the term. This fee is the same as any other fee charged to students, and is covered by financial aid and scholarships if utilized by a student. If a student drops all of their classes during the add/drop period in the Fall or Spring, they are no longer eligible for a U-Pass and access will be removed. If a student withdraws from classes after the add/drop period and retain some or all of their tuition charges during the Fall or Spring they will remain eligible for the U-Pass until the term ends. During the summer term, only enrolled students can access the U-Pass. If you drop or withdraw from classes during the summer term, you are no longer eligible for the U-Pass.
